DETAILED DESCRIPTION OF THE INVENTION The present invention relates to a pallet transfer device capable of moving between a truck bed and a cargo field.

In order to streamline cargo transportation and save labor, pallets are used to load cargo between truck beds and cargo storage areas via sliding parts such as rollers installed in large numbers in parallel to transport cargo between specific locations. A method has been proposed in which the pallet is made movable and the pallet is transferred using appropriate power.

Therefore, the height of the cargo battlefield is 'the height of the truck bed'.
However, in this type of logistics transportation system that actually uses a large number of trucks, the heights of the truck loading area and the loading area do not match, so they are usually built at an appropriate distance and a treadle is installed here. The work is carried out by hand.

Therefore, when transferring pallets, it is necessary to move the pallets beyond the range of this treadle, and the power source installed on either the Atsushi storage site or the truck side, such as a winch, must be used. However, considerable labor is required for each cargo handling operation.

In addition, a winch is installed on the truck side, and when using this winch to pull a pallet from the training yard onto the loading platform, if the loading platform is tilted forward and downward, the pallet will run on its own during the pull-in process and end up at the edge of the loading platform. It is also inconvenient from a safety point of view, as there are many cases where the vehicle collides with other objects. The present invention was invented in view of the above points, and is provided on the truck side,
To provide a pallet transfer device that allows pallets to be freely moved between a loading platform and a loading area with or without a treadle, and also prevents the pallets from running on their own and eliminates various troubles caused by this at once. In the figure, 1 is the chassis of the truck, 2 is a loading platform provided on this chassis, and 3 is a group of many rollers arranged in parallel in the longitudinal direction on the surface of the loading platform 2, on which a pallet 4 slides.

Reference numeral 6 denotes an extension frame provided at the rear end of the loading platform 2 so that it can freely protrude and retract in the direction of movement of the pallet 4. The first half of the frame is inserted into the loading platform 2, and the second half is curved into a crank shape and extends outward from the loading platform surface. It extends to

Reference numeral 6 denotes a wire that is suspended between the frame body 5 and the loading platform 2, facing the loading platform surface and forming an upper running part 6'.
At the front part of the loading platform 2, it is stretched over a pulley 7 which is attached with an outward elastic force applied by a spring, and at the rear of the loading platform 2, it is stretched over a pulley 8 attached to the rear end of the frame body 5. The front half of the body 5 is folded over in an S-shape between a pulley 9 attached to the front end of the frame 5 and a pulley 10 attached to the rear end of the loading platform 2.

Reference numeral 11 denotes a wire running mechanism mounted under the loading platform, and its main components include a motor 12 and winding drums 13 and 14 connected to this motor 12. Both ends of 6 are wound and fastened with the winding direction reversed.

In effect, therefore, the wire 16 is laid out so as to perform the same effect as in an endless (inorganic) state. 15
1 is a means for engaging the pallet 4 provided on the upper running portion 6' of the wire 16; in the illustrated example, the hook 16 can be freely engaged with and detached from a pin 17 provided on the pallet 4.

Reference numeral 18 is a locking pin between the frame 5 and the loading platform 2, which allows the frame 5 to tilt while the frame 5 is largely pulled out to the rear of the loading platform.
The pin insertion hole 19 of the frame body 5 is formed in the shape of an elongated hole.

In the figure, reference numeral 20 denotes a concave groove formed through the loading platform surface, and the upper running portion 6' of the wire 16 is located in this concave groove.
It is designed to run around the lower levels. Further, the integrated drums 13 and 14 are used to switch the rotational direction of the motor 12,
Alternatively, the direction of rotation is changed by a rotational direction cutting mechanism attached to the groove, so that the wire 16 can freely move back and forth.

The present invention is constructed as described above, and its operation will be explained when the pallet 4 is moved from the loading platform 2 to the Atsushi Yard 21. By driving a truck, the rear end of the loading platform 2 approaches the battlefield 21. First, pull out the extension frame 5 in the gap between the two and hang the rear end on the battlefield 21.
The locking pin 18 is inserted into the pin insertion hole 19 of the frame body 5 and fixed, and the footboard 22 is hung over it.

When the frame 5 is pulled out and extended, the wire 16 is wrapped around the pulley 9 of the frame 5 and the pulley 10 of the loading platform 2 in an S-shape, so it is independent of the rotation of the wire 1. It's huge and can be pulled out freely. Next, the motor 12 is started to rotate the upper running part 6' of the wire 16 backwards by winding and manipulating both ends of the wire 1 to the pair of drums 13 and 14. The pallet 4 engaged by the hook 16 also moves together, and eventually the hook 16 reaches the rear end of the frame 5 and the pallet 4
The pallet 4 is moved over the footboard 22 to the battlefield 21, where the hook 16 is disengaged from the pallet 4, and the transfer work is completed. In addition, when the pallet 4 is pulled in and transferred from the loading area 21 to the loading platform 2, the operation may be performed based on the reverse order of the above operations.

As is clear from the above description, the device of the present invention is installed on the bed of a truck, and in order to transfer pallets between the bed and the cargo storage area, one end of the pallet is connected to a wire having an upper running part on the surface of the bed. The two are moved together when they are engaged, and the extension frame over which the wire 1 is stretched can be moved in and out of the loading platform, regardless of the rotation of the wire 1, so that there is no space between the end of the loading platform and the battlefield. Even if there is a gap between the pallets, the pallet can be moved over the gap and reliably transferred, and there is no need to change wires between loading and unloading the pallet. The work can be simplified without bothering the personnel.

In addition, even while the pallet is being moved, the restraint relationship by the wire 1 is maintained, so the pallet does not move by itself due to the slope of the loading platform, and it is safe, and the wire 1 does not become sagging. There are no problems caused by slack wires, and there are no problems caused by slack wires.
Furthermore, the structure is simple, the space under the loading platform can be used effectively, and it is easy to handle.
